ZdenekSrotyr 1acc89c486 fix(ci): move bind-mount of /data to separate overlay, fix CI smoke test
The CI smoke test failed because docker-compose.prod.yml forced a bind mount
to /data on the host — which doesn't exist on GitHub runners.

Split the bind mount into docker-compose.host-mount.yml, which is only
composed by the VM startup script (/data exists there, mounted from the
persistent disk). CI continues to use the default named volume.

Module startup script + auto-upgrade cron now compose all three:
  -f docker-compose.yml -f docker-compose.prod.yml -f docker-compose.host-mount.yml

# Bind-mount overlay — replaces the `data` named volume with a bind mount
# to /data on the host.
#
# Use this when /data is a persistent disk mounted by the VM startup script,
# so Agnes data lives on the PD (not on the boot disk's Docker volume).
#
# Usage (combined with docker-compose.prod.yml):
# docker compose \
# -f docker-compose.yml \
# -f docker-compose.prod.yml \
# -f docker-compose.host-mount.yml \
# up -d
#
# Do NOT use this overlay in CI — /data does not exist on GitHub runners.
volumes:
data:
driver: local
driver_opts:
type: none
o: bind
device: /data
